Output a8c70179b544b4b97cc91df17417c889d5cfda70923b92c177577891fcb691ae:0

value
24328286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03482632f21c9164142d2d18296fb2a6a452b96e OP_EQUAL
address
31zNP8kyWCo8RnfAqQQd261GH2PzdaRwwq
transaction
a8c70179b544b4b97cc91df17417c889d5cfda70923b92c177577891fcb691ae
spent
true